G2 reviewers report that Bynder excels in user satisfaction, boasting a significantly higher overall score compared to Salsify PXM. Users appreciate the platform's intuitive design, making it easy to manage thousands of creative documents without the clutter of a traditional folder-based system.
Users say that Bynder's onboarding process is particularly noteworthy, with many highlighting the dedicated support team that guides them through setup. This level of assistance has been described as "incredibly helpful," ensuring a smooth transition for new users.
Reviewers mention that Salsify PXM shines in its ability to integrate with various retailers and marketplaces, allowing for centralized product content management. This feature is praised for creating a "single source of truth," which helps maintain consistency across multiple digital channels.
According to verified reviews, Bynder's quality of support stands out, with users rating it highly for responsiveness and effectiveness. Many have noted that the support team is knowledgeable and patient, which enhances the overall user experience.
Users highlight that while Salsify PXM offers a range of tools for managing product data, some find the interface less intuitive compared to Bynder. This can lead to challenges in navigating the platform, especially for new users who may require more guidance.
G2 reviewers indicate that Bynder's analytics capabilities, although not the highest rated, still provide valuable insights that help users track asset performance. In contrast, Salsify PXM's analytics features are seen as less robust, which may limit users' ability to derive actionable insights from their data.
